Just right click on object - octane properties - movable proxy. Then you can copy objects in instance mode.gueoct wrote:Is there a way to use several HiRes trees in a scene without MultiScatter or ForestPack?
is there a sort of proxy for huge geometry?
As far as I understand he means proxy models like VRayProxy object is?Karba wrote: Just right click on object - octane properties - movable proxy. Then you can copy objects in instance mode.
That in the viewport you have a proxy point cloud and real mesh shows up only during rendering.
That would make views lighter and allow us to render heavy geometry and scenes with a lot of instances without the need for MultiScatter or ForestPack.
